Chelsea FC star John Obi Mikel charged with drink driving

26 January 2009 12:12
Mikel, 21, was pulled over by officers while driving his Range Rover near the club's Stamford Bridge stadium in west London at 5.30am on Saturday morning. [LNB]The £40,000-a-week midfielder, who lives in Surrey, was given a breath test and put in a police cell. [LNB]He had been charged and bailed by the time Chelsea beat Ipswich 3-1 on Saturday afternoon. Nigerian international Mikel was serving a one match suspension for accruing five yellow cards, so was not available to play in the match. [LNB]He faces a minimum of a year's driving ban and a maximum of six months in jail with a £5,000 fine if convicted. He is due to appear in court in April. [LNB]A Scotland Yard spokesman said: "John Obi Mikel, 21, from Weybridge, will appear on bail at West London Magistrates Court on April 3 charged with driving a motor vehicle whilst over the limit." [LNB]A spokesman for Chelsea FC said: "We are aware he was arrested and charged. We want to establish the facts before we comment."[LNB]
